ICT In The Heart Of LOTE Curriculum: Calling For Action
Anat Wilson
Non Refereed Paper on friday, 9 April 2010 11:15 - 11:45 in room 207
TAGS: Curriculum, Secondary School, Web Tools, Communicating, LOTE, Web 2.0
This paper looks at the rational behind, and the practical aspects of, creating and supporting an ‘umbrella website’ as a fundamental core teaching tool for all Languages other than English (LOTE) secondary school curriculum materials. Although acknowledging that some ICT is currently interwoven into LOTE curriculums, this paper argues these minor additions are far from fulfilling the need of ICT in LOTE. Subject teachers are facing constant difficulties in implementing ICT activities, which will be outlined and further discussed. A program revolving around a professionally maintained website, which would fully utilize Web2 technologies, connect students to the LOTE virtual communities and maximize students’ exposure to the target language, is utterly essential in any LOTE curriculum. Students’ independent learning abilities will be enhanced and developed as they can access LOTE learning materials by themselves, from anywhere outside the classroom.
